NUISANCE BONFIRES & GARDEN WASTE DISPOSAL

This is a further request that you be considerate about when and where you have a bonfire.  It is not friendly to smoke out your neighbours (especially on hot summer days and evenings when windows may be open) and also you may be creating a health hazard.

It is perfectly reasonable to have a bonfire but a bit of thought and care about the time, the location and the weather conditions can minimise any unpleasant side effects and avoid upsetting your immediate neighbourhood.

To avoid such possible problems and if you have trouble disposing of garden waste then you can join the NFDC’s Garden Waste Scheme which is an easy, affordable way for New Forest residents to dispose of their garden waste.  Bags are collected once a fortnight and composted at a Hampshire facility.

Click here for further information or ring 023 8028 5000.

Alternatively you can take garden waste to the local household waste recycling centre.  Click here for further information or ring 0845 603 5634.

If bonfires are causing a nuisance then it is possible for an Abatement Order to be served upon the person responsible, owner or occupier of the premises (as appropriate) requiring the nuisance to be abated.  Failure to comply with an Abatement Notice is an offence and legal proceedings may result.
